The Science of Hydration and Weight Fluctuation

When you step on the scale and see a sudden, small jump in weight after a day of increased hydration, it's easy to assume the water is to blame. In a way, it is—but not in the way you think. The key to understanding this phenomenon is distinguishing between temporary "water weight" and permanent body fat. A liter of water weighs approximately one kilogram (or about 2.2 pounds), so consuming it adds that immediate mass to your body. However, this mass is not stored as fat tissue and is quickly processed and excreted by your body's regulatory systems.

How Your Body Manages Fluid Balance

Your body is a finely-tuned machine with sophisticated mechanisms for maintaining fluid balance. The kidneys, in particular, play a crucial role in filtering excess water and waste from the blood. When you drink a large amount of water, your kidneys increase their output to excrete the extra fluid through urination. Your body also expels water through sweat and breathing. This continuous process of intake and elimination is why the scale can change throughout the day, but a single day of high water intake does not result in permanent weight gain.

Adequate hydration is, in fact, an ally in weight management. Drinking water can help you feel full, potentially reducing overall calorie intake. It also aids in boosting metabolism, improving digestion, and flushing out waste. Conversely, dehydration can cause your body to hold onto water as a survival mechanism, leading to temporary water retention.

Factors Contributing to Water Retention

While drinking plenty of water does not cause fat gain, several other factors can lead to temporary fluid retention, which can be mistaken for weight gain. These include:

  • High Sodium Intake: Consuming salty foods causes your body to hold onto extra water to dilute the sodium concentration in your bloodstream. This is a common cause of short-term bloating.
  • Carbohydrate Consumption: For every gram of glycogen your body stores, it retains about 3 to 4 grams of water. This is why a person on a low-carb diet may see a rapid initial weight drop (shedding water) and why a high-carb meal can cause temporary weight gain.
  • Hormonal Changes: Many women experience water retention and bloating around their menstrual cycle due to fluctuating hormone levels.
  • Certain Medications: Some medications, including steroids and blood pressure drugs, can cause the body to retain more water than usual.
  • Lack of Physical Activity: Sitting or standing for long periods can cause fluid to accumulate in your lower extremities.

The Risks of Overhydration

While it's difficult for a healthy person to overhydrate accidentally, drinking excessive amounts of water in a short time can be dangerous. Overhydration can lead to hyponatremia, a condition where sodium levels in the blood become dangerously low. This can cause cells, including brain cells, to swell, leading to symptoms like headaches, nausea, and confusion. In severe, rare cases, it can be fatal. The kidneys of a healthy adult can process about one liter of fluid per hour, so it's wise not to exceed this rate.

How to Manage Water Weight Effectively

If you are experiencing noticeable water retention, there are healthy ways to manage it without restricting your overall water intake. Here's a quick rundown:

  1. Cut back on sodium: Limit your intake of processed foods, canned soups, and salty snacks. Use herbs and spices for flavor instead.
  2. Stay hydrated consistently: Drinking water throughout the day helps your body flush out excess sodium and waste.
  3. Exercise regularly: Movement and sweating help to eliminate excess water and improve circulation.
  4. Eat potassium-rich foods: Foods like bananas, spinach, and sweet potatoes help balance sodium levels in the body.
  5. Focus on long-term trends: The most important thing is to avoid panicking over daily scale fluctuations. Focus on consistent, healthy habits for long-term progress.

FAQs

Q: How can I tell if my weight gain is water weight or fat? A: Water weight fluctuates rapidly (day-to-day or hour-to-hour) and is often accompanied by bloating, while fat gain occurs slowly over time due to a caloric surplus.

Q: Can I lose weight by drinking less water? A: No, intentionally dehydrating yourself is dangerous and not a sustainable or healthy weight loss method. Any temporary weight loss from reduced water intake is not fat loss and can negatively impact your health.

Q: How much water is considered a lot? A: For a healthy adult, kidneys can process about 1 liter of fluid per hour. Drinking significantly more than this over a short period can be dangerous, but the exact amount varies.

Q: Can a high-sodium meal cause me to retain water? A: Yes, consuming a lot of sodium causes your body to retain extra water to balance the sodium concentration, leading to temporary water weight.

Q: What is the risk of drinking too much water? A: Drinking too much water in a short time can cause hyponatremia (low blood sodium), which can lead to symptoms like headaches, nausea, and, in severe cases, seizures or coma.

Q: Is it okay to weigh myself after drinking a lot of water? A: Yes, but be aware that the scale will temporarily show an increase due to the fluid's mass. For a more accurate long-term trend, it's best to weigh yourself consistently, ideally first thing in the morning.

Q: What is the normal daily fluctuation in body weight? A: It's normal for a person's weight to fluctuate by 1-5 pounds in a single day due to changes in hydration, food intake, and other factors.
